#ifndef TENSORFLOW_LITE_MICRO_EXAMPLES_MAGIC_WAND_CONSTANTS_H_
#define TENSORFLOW_LITE_MICRO_EXAMPLES_MAGIC_WAND_CONSTANTS_H_

/* The expected accelerometer data sample frequency */
const float kTargetHz = 25;

/* What gestures are supported. */
constexpr int kGestureCount = 4;
constexpr int kWingGesture = 0;
constexpr int kRingGesture = 1;
constexpr int kSlopeGesture = 2;
constexpr int kNoGesture = 3;

/* These control the sensitivity of the detection algorithm. If you're seeing
 * too many false positives or not enough true positives, you can try tweaking
 * these thresholds. Often, increasing the size of the training set will give
 * more robust results though, so consider retraining if you are seeing poor
 * predictions.
 */
constexpr float kDetectionThreshold = 0.8f;
constexpr int kPredictionHistoryLength = 5;
constexpr int kPredictionSuppressionDuration = 25;

#endif /* TENSORFLOW_LITE_MICRO_EXAMPLES_MAGIC_WAND_CONSTANTS_H_ */
